Service science

Service science is an emerging field without a globally accepted definition. This amalgamation of computer science, business and economics looks at the best way to serve society, companies and governments by using the right technology. Business and IT have complete different definitions of ‘service’. For the business it is anything that can be bought and sold. IT only looks at the part which can be performed on a machine and which communicates with other machines. However, the only way successful services can be designed is when both worlds understand each other. Models need to be completely correct from a business, economics and computer science point of view.
